BRAND DIRECTOR | SYDNEY (5 DAYS ON SITE) | GLOBAL WOMENSWEAR
A globally recognised womenswear brand is seeking a Brand Director to lead the next phase of its international brand growth strategy. Operating within a founder-led, fast-paced ecommerce environment, this opportunity sits at the intersection of brand storytelling, commercial performance and cultural relevance.
With a significant global footprint across the US, UK and Australia, the business has experienced substantial growth over recent years and continues to scale both its product offering and internal capabilities. Approximately 75% of revenue is generated through the US market, with the UK representing a major expansion focus moving forward. The business operates multiple international websites and fulfilment centres across key regions, creating a highly dynamic and globally connected trading environment.
The company has evolved rapidly from a digitally-led fashion retailer into a more sophisticated own-brand product business, with strong investment being made across product, brand and customer experience functions. The environment is highly collaborative, entrepreneurial and fast-moving, making it well suited to candidates who thrive within founder-led businesses and enjoy balancing strategic thinking with hands-on execution.
THE ROLE
Reporting into senior leadership, the Brand Director will own the overarching global brand and go-to-market strategy, ensuring all campaigns, launches and brand moments are aligned across Product, Ecommerce, Creative and Marketing teams.
This role will sit at the centre of the brand’s global growth strategy, acting as the bridge between creative storytelling and commercial performance. The successful candidate will lead the direction of social, PR, influencer, partnerships and experiential activity while continuing to evolve the brand’s cultural relevance across international markets.

RESPONSIBILITIES +
- Lead the global brand and GTM strategy across seasonal launches, campaigns and product drops
- Oversee influencer, ambassador, PR and partnerships strategy across key international markets
- Build and evolve a highly engaged community and ambassador ecosystem to drive brand advocacy and organic reach
- Lead organic social direction across TikTok, Instagram and emerging platforms
- Develop and execute large-scale experiential activations including pop-ups, VIP events and cultural partnerships
- Ensure strong brand governance and consistency across all creative, social and campaign output
- Collaborate cross-functionally with Product, Creative, Ecommerce and Marketing teams to align brand and commercial objectives
- Identify culturally relevant opportunities, trends and emerging consumer behaviours to keep the brand at the forefront of the market
- Analyse campaign performance, social engagement and customer insights to inform future brand strategy
REQUIREMENTS +
- Extensive experience within Brand, Partnerships, Influencer or Integrated Marketing leadership roles
- Strong background within fashion, lifestyle or digitally-native consumer brands
- Proven success leading integrated global campaigns within fast-paced ecommerce businesses
- Experience building community-led marketing strategies and ambassador programs
- Strong understanding of social-first customer acquisition and brand growth
- Ability to balance creative vision with commercial outcomes and data-driven decision making
- Experience managing cross-functional teams and collaborating with senior stakeholders
- Someone who thrives in founder-led, entrepreneurial environments and enjoys working at pace
- Deep understanding of Gen Z consumer behaviour, fashion culture and emerging social trends
